C语言中是可以引用另外一个源文件的全局数组的,但是不能引用局部数组。
引用方式举例如下:
-
设a.c文件有有数据定义
int array1[10];
-
现有b.c文件中想访问a.c中的array1数组
-
那么b.c文件中首先添加如下语句
extern int array1[10];
-
然后就可以访问数组array1和它的元素了。
C语言中是可以引用另外一个源文件的全局数组的,但是不能引用局部数组。
引用方式举例如下:
设a.c文件有有数据定义
int array1[10];
现有b.c文件中想访问a.c中的array1数组
那么b.c文件中首先添加如下语句
extern int array1[10];
然后就可以访问数组array1和它的元素了。